| Catalog Number | orb1788123 |
|---|---|
| Category | Antibodies |
| Description | Purified Rabbit Polyclonal Antibody (Pab) |
| Target | This STRADA antibody is generated from a rabbit immunized with a KLH conjugated synthetic peptide between 303-346 amino acids from the C-terminal region of human STRADA. |
| Clonality | Polyclonal |
| Species/Host | Rabbit |
| Isotype | Rabbit IgG |
| Conjugation | Unconjugated |
| Reactivity | Human, Mouse |
| Form/Appearance | Purified polyclonal antibody supplied in PBS with 0.09% (W/V) sodium azide. This antibody is purified through a protein A column, followed by peptide affinity purification. |
| Immunogen | 303-346 aa |
| UniProt ID | Q7RTN6 |
| MW | 48369 Da |
| Tested applications | FC, IF, IHC-P, WB |
| Dilution range | IF: 1:25, WB: 1:1000, IHC-P: 1:25, IHC-P: 1:25, IHC-P: 1:25, IHC-P: 1:25, FC: 1:25 |
| Antibody Type | Primary Antibody |
| Storage | Maintain refrigerated at 2-8°C for up to 2 weeks. For long term storage store at -20°C in small aliquots to prevent freeze-thaw cycles |
| Alternative names | STE20-related kinase adapter protein alpha, STRAD Read more... |
| Note | For research use only |

Immunohistochemical analysis of paraffin-embedded M. liver section using STRADA Antibody (C-term). Diluted at 1: 100 dilution. A peroxidase-conjugated goat anti-rabbit IgG at 1:400 dilution was used as the secondary antibody, followed by DAB staining.

Immunohistochemical analysis of paraffin-embedded H. liver section using STRADA Antibody (C-term). Diluted at 1: 100 dilution. A peroxidase-conjugated goat anti-rabbit IgG at 1:400 dilution was used as the secondary antibody, followed by DAB staining.

Immunohistochemical analysis of paraffin-embedded M. duodenum section using STRADA Antibody (C-term). Diluted at 1: 100 dilution. A peroxidase-conjugated goat anti-rabbit IgG at 1:400 dilution was used as the secondary antibody, followed by DAB staining.

Immunohistochemical analysis of paraffin-embedded H. duodenum section using STRADA Antibody (C-term). Diluted at 1: 100 dilution. A peroxidase-conjugated goat anti-rabbit IgG at 1:400 dilution was used as the secondary antibody, followed by DAB staining.

Flow cytometric analysis of SH-SY5Y cells using STRADA Antibody (C-term) (green) compared to an isotype control of rabbit IgG (blue). Diluted at 1:25 dilution. An Alexa Fluor 488 goat anti-rabbit lgG at 1:400 dilution was used as the secondary antibody.

Fluorescent image of A549 cells stained with STRADA Antibody (C-term). Diluted at 1:25 dilution. An Alexa Fluor 488-conjugated goat anti-rabbit lgG at 1:400 dilution was used as the secondary antibody (green). Cytoplasmic actin was counterstained with Alexa Fluor 555 conjugated with Phalloidin (red).

All lanes: Anti-STRADA Antibody (C-term) at 1:1000 dilution. Lane 1: 293T whole cell lysates. Lane 2: human brain lysates. Lane 3: mouse brain lysates. Lysates/proteins at 20 µg per lane. Secondary Goat Anti-Rabbit IgG, (H+L), Peroxidase conjugated at 1/10000 dilution. Predicted band size: 48 kDa. Blocking/Dilution buffer: 5% NFDM/TBST.
